Preston L. Cole

Preston L. Cole, also known as Alabam, 79, Tipton,  died at 6:00 p.m. Sunday, September 24, 2006 at Tipton Hospital.  He was born February 1, 1927 in Guin, Alabama to Jesse P. & Golda (LeDuke) Cole.  On March 9, 1963, he married Nancy Goar and she survives.

He was self employed most of his life and for the last 30 years he owned and operated Cole's Backhoe Service.  He was affiliated with the United Methodist Church, was a member of the Tipton Elks, American Legion and National Rifle Association.  Preston was a combat engineer in the U.S. Army during WWII.
